Can I book an all inclusive package if I choose an historic wedding venue?
es, many historic wedding venues in the UK offer all-inclusive packages that include catering, flowers, music, and other wedding essentials. These packages can be a convenient and stress-free option for couples who want everything taken care of in one place. However, it's important to read the fine print and make sure that the package includes everything you need, and that there are no hidden fees or extra costs.
Do historic wedding venues include accomodation?
Many historic wedding venues in the UK do offer accommodation options for guests. This can range from onsite rooms or suites to nearby hotels or B&Bs that the venue has partnered with. Some venues may also offer exclusive use of the property for the entire wedding party, giving you and your guests a unique and unforgettable experience.
What are some of the best historic wedding venues in the UK?
The UK has a wealth of historic wedding venues that provide a unique and stunning backdrop for your special day. Some of the best include Blenheim Palace in Oxfordshire, Hampton Court Palace in London, Warwick Castle in Warwickshire, Chatsworth House in Derbyshire, and Edinburgh Castle in Scotland. Each venue offers a mix of grandeur, history, and beauty that can make your wedding day truly memorable.

Will my historic wedding venue be haunted?
While some historic wedding venues in the UK are rumored to be haunted, this is not necessarily the case for all venues. Some venues embrace their ghostly legends and offer ghost tours, while others focus on the beauty and history of the location. If you're interested in finding out whether a particular venue is haunted, you can always ask the venue or read online reviews from previous guests.
